New Research Finds Flame Retardants Produce Deadlier Fires

Products like baby mattresses and car seats that use flame retardants [5] have come under heavy scrutiny in recent years because they contain powerful toxins that are known to cause impaired neurological development and a variety of other health problems. In an ironic twist, new research suggests [6] that flame retardants, even though they may slow the spread of flames, can produce deadlier fires. A not-yet-published study in Great Britain finds that flame retardants increase the amounts of carbon monoxide and hydrogen cyanide — two of the biggest killers in fires — when they are burned. Few details about the new research have been released so far, but this sounds like another strong case against the continued use of flame retardants.
